Authentication
✋ Token generation and usage
Once you have created your company in Sibill, we will generate an authentication token to make requests to the APIs. The token is unique per company and does not expire. After the token is generated, we will send you an email with your access credentials.
The access credentials consist of:
- company_id: the company ID required by the APIs
- token: the authentication token to be used in the
Authorizationheader
warning
Access credentials are personal and must not be shared with third parties.
info
Access credentials will not be sent in plain text via email. They will be encrypted and protected through a one-time access link that can only be used once.
✅ Making an API request
GET /api/v1/companies
HTTP/1.1
Host: integration.dev.sibill.com
Accept: application/json
Authorization: Bearer f2bc53412c0f062bee8b57e39a62b2ced634beee1a5bd9c1db4f9b0cee34ef1c